What is a URL? How to Optimize a URL for Better SEO?

What is URL?

A URL (Uniform Resource Locater) is technically a type of Uniform Resource Identifier (URI) that specifies the location of a webpage. In simple words, a URL may be defined as a "wepage address" or "website address".

Example of a URL: http://www.Google.com and http://www.google.com/adwords

Types of URL

A URL may be divided in to two types and can be understood by the following examples:

1) Static URL: An example of a static URL is www.example.com/this-is-my-website-first-page. Static URL will contain only keywords and will not include any special characters.  Websites which are made only in simple HTML are the best example of a static URL. Static URLs are good for an SEO point of view.

2) Dynamic URL: An example of a Dynamic URL is www.example .com/product?id=105. Dynamic URLs will always contain special characters like?=/ etc. Websites made in PHP may be an example of  dynamic URLs. Dynamic URLs are not good for an SEO point of view.

Tips for Optimization of URL

URL optimization is one of the important factors for SEO on page activity. Even Google and other search engines are always recommending to try to make static URLs for your webpages. If you do not know how to do URL optimization for your website then the example below will be beneficial for you.

If you are designing a new website and naming your folder, then take time to name your URLs. Try to include the actual name of the product or category name in the URLs or you can use your important or related keywords in the URLs.

For example, if we have a page on the topic of ‘Mangoes are Sweet’ and it is under the ‘Fruit’ category then we can assign URL as

www.example.com/fruits/mangoes-are-sweet (Static URL).

We recommend to use a hyphen (-) in between the keywords and ignore underscore (_)

Ignore these types of URL www.example.com /product?id=567 (Dynamic URL)
www.example.com/products /567.html (Dynamic URL)

So, by assigning static URL, Google and other search engines can easily crawl your website. Simply put, we can say try to make static URL’s for your website instead of making dynamic URL’s.

The main purpose of URL optimization is that these are more searchable; Google robots can easily find your website.

Google Updates October 2012

Another great recap from OrderDynamics on Google's latest changes.

During September, many businesses saw great fluctuation in their SERP rank. Several changes and updates to the Google Platforms and algorithms explain why, and how they can be used to improve business practices

Google Search
The Panda algorithm underwent three changes in September, the first taking place September 18. Google tweeted that a Panda refresh was rolling out on September 18, and that less than 0.7% of search queries would be affected. 

A much greater change was Panda’s 20th algorithm update on September 28, which Google reported affected 2.4% of search queries. The next day, Google performed what is now being called the EMD Update, targeted at exact-match domain searches. Previously, a website would automatically rank higher if the domain name matched the search query; however Google noted that many exact-match results were not necessarily of very good quality. The algorithm change, which Google asserts is not related to Panda or Penguin as they are actually algorithm filters – not algorithms themselves -  is aimed at better differentiating exact-match domain search results based on the quality of the website. Matt Cutts of Google tweeted that the EMD Update would impact 0.6% of searches, but given the proximity of the Panda and EMD Updates, many are struggling to understand which of the two has actually affected their site.

On the Google Search blog, Google announced the merger of search trend tools Google Insights for Search and Google Trends into the New Google Trends. The merger was aimed at consolidating the two tools as the data rendered for both is based on search behaviour. Google reported that the featured charts and tools are now based on HTML5, so that they can be loaded on mobile devices.

Google Updates September 2012

Another great post from Canada's leading ecommerce platform provider....

August was a busy month for Google. With updates to Panda, PageRank, Analytics and AdWords, many businesses saw shifts in search engine rank and search results. Here’s what was changed, how it affected businesses, and what these changes mean moving forward.

Google Search & Panda 3.9.1
Google tweeted on August 23 about the Panda 3.9.1 update, stating “Panda data refresh this past Monday. ~1% of queries noticeably affected”.  Effectively, this meant the refresh was deployed on August 20, less than a month after the Panda 3.9 refresh on July 24. Google has not made any additional comments to elaborate on exactly what the refresh was meant to address.

On August 10, Google announced on their Inside Search Blog the implementation of a new ‘signal’ to indicate when copyrighted information is being violated. The signal has been nicknamed in the online community the ‘Emanuel Update’ after Ari Emanuel of William Morris Endeavour asserted earlier this year that Google has the ability to filter copyrighted content from search results, the same way it does with child pornography. Emanuel stated, “stealing is a bad thing, and child pornography is a bad thing”. The new signal sends copyright removal notices to Google when it suspects copyright infringement; the more notifications Google receives regarding any given website, the lower that site will rank in search results. However, this is the most Google can do to websites suspected of copyright violations; they cannot de-index sites that are repeatedly accused of copyright violations unless a copyright holder actually approaches and asks them to. Those de-indexed can submit counter-notices thereafter to petition to be re-indexed. This is the first Google update pertaining to copyright management in two years.

On-Page SEO Checklist, Top 10 Tips

Here are 10 important on-page SEO considerations for everyone who runs a website. SEOCopyKids.com follows these simple principals when we optimize websites for our clients.

#1 Standards-Based Pages: 
It is very important build your website following HTML W3C Standards which basically means your website will be read properly by a search engine and people browsing your website. A great designer isn't typically a great HTML coder. You really do need to think about the performance of your HTML pages to ensure they're error-free with lowest possible load times and that you aren't violating basic SEO rules. 

#2 Page Title Tag: 
This is the title of your page and one of the most important factors in SEO. Page titles should reflect the individual product you're selling. Title tags are shown in the search engine results page. 

For example: 1968 Rookie Card of John Smith - Millioncards.org.

#3 Keywords: 
Start thinking about your keywords right away as this will drive many of the decisions below. Pick keywords and phrases that your target customer will use to find your product. If you're using Pay Per Click (PPC) advertising, these keywords and Ads should align. 

For example: 1960s Rookie Hockey Cards

#4 Page Content: 
You've probably heard this a million times already but its key to a successful SEO strategy. If your pages do not have relevant content they will not service your Customers and the search engines will not rank your page effectively against your keywords.

#5 Page File Name (URL): 
This is the actual html page name. 

For example: millioncards.org/rookie-cards/1968-rookie-card-john-smith.html

#6 Meta Keywords Tag: 
These are the most likely words or phrases that will help a customer find your product and are embedded in the HTML code. 

For example: Rookie Hockey Cards, John Smith Hockey Cards, 1960s Hockey Cards.

#7 Meta Description Tag: 
This a description of your pages and should be a short, 1-2 sentences (max 200-250 characters) that describes the content on the page. It is also shown in the search engines below the page title. This should briefly describe the product and be unique from the page title. 

For example: Millioncards provides rare Rookie Hockey Cards for collectors or gifts for hockey fans. This John Smith Rookie Card is in mint condition and includes protective case.

#8 Anchor Text (text links): 
Anchor text is very important in keyword use. This is the text found on your website that appears as a hyperlink. Anchor text should be relevant and can be used to link within your website to relevant pages.

#9 Header Tags: 
Allows you to organize your pages into relevant sections by topic from the H1 Page topic header, H2 main topic, and H3 and sub topics, and so on. Headers give the search engines and understanding of where the important information is on the product page and allow you to utilize your keywords for topic areas that describe the product.

#10 Alt Image Attribute: 
Alt image attributes should be used for every image on your website. Alt attributes, provide a description to the search engine about what the image is (since search engine robots cannot "see") and displayed to the user prior to loading the image. Keep these short and relevant to what the picture is illustrating.

Google Updates August 2012

Our friends at OrderDynamics, Canada's leading ecommerce provider, released this great post about the recent updates to Google. This is part of their monthly series and we will repost most of the article here, for the complete blog, OrderDynamics Google Monthly Updates August 2012.

On July 18, Google officially retired the original version of Google Analytics. While having rolled out the newer version in March 2012, users were able to switch back to the older version for some time before Google slowly began removing the option.  The new Google Analytics brings with it several new features, as well as simpler ways to use veteran features.

Multi-Channel Funnels API
Google implemented an API for their Multi-Channel Funnels feature with great interest to developers. The feature allows users to establish various metrics related to conversion, such as the most common channels and paths through a web site leading to up to sale.  Metric types include Assisted Conversions, Top Path, Path Length, Time Lag, and others. The data collected using Multi-Channel Funnels can be combined with data from other platforms to establish advanced metrics;Google’s Official Analytics blog noted how analytics company Mazeberry Express combined media expenditure with conversion path data to establish Cost per Acquisition and Return on Investment.

Real-Time
Data yielded by Analytics is now real-time, and can provide feedback on exactly what has occurred on a website thus far in a day.

Social Reports
Social Analytics allows users to track how social media activity leads to traffic and conversions to a website. Users can now tell which social networks generate the most traffic and conversions, and how social media users interact with a brand on the social network itself. Google’s Social Reports generates reports such as:

●    Social Visitor Flow
●    Off-Site Activity - Social Data Hub
●    Activity Stream
●    Social Value at a Glance
●    Assisted vs. Last Interaction Analysis
●    Multi-Channel Funnel

Mobile Reports
Mobile Reports will prove to be a game changer, offering extensive information on how consumers interact with mobile devices with respect to a brand’s website and mobile app. Users will now be able to measure the analytics of their mobile app the same way they would a regular website, geo-locate where consumers are when using their app or mobile site, and which mobile platforms work best with the brand’s app and mobile site. The feature is not exclusive to smartphones - it utilizes data from any web-enabled mobile device.

Content Experiments
This feature is not new, but has been made much simpler to use. Previously known as Google Web Optimizer, Content Experiments allows for A/B testing within Google Analytics. Content Experiments asserts that it is an improvement over its predecessor in that statistics are better analyzed by preserving data for 2 weeks before making test results available, and automatically deleting tests that run longer than 3 months. It also automatically diverts test traffic away from low performing test pages to better performing ones to preserve data from being skewed. Content Experiments is also different from Web Optimizer because the testing feature is already within analytics, whereas Web Optimizer required hacks and code implementations to link test pages to Analytics.

Remarketing
Remarketing is a feature of the Google AdWords program that automatically has a brand’s ads follow a consumer after they have visited a site. The Remarketing feature within Analytics generates reports on consumer behaviour on a site to determine their exact preferences, and the data from these reports is then sent to AdWords to allow users to tailor their Remarketing ad campaigns according to exactly what their consumers want. This feature is automatically available to anyone with an existing AdWords account linked to their Analytics.

Google Panda & Penguin
With respect to these Google Algorithms, it has been a notably quiet month. On July 24, Google Tweeted about the Panda 3.9 data refresh. The results of the refresh were low-impact, affecting only 1% of search results over 5-6 days post-refresh. It is important to note that a data refresh is not the same as an algorithm update. This, and having made an uncommon two data refreshes in June which likely rendered last month’s update relatively minor, is likely the cause of only a minimal backlash post-update. As for Penguin, it has been 9 weeks - also uncommon for Google - since the last update, and there has been no news on when to expect the next one.
